ok, i know this deal is mentioned in the $5-$20 off circuit city thread, but alot of people might overlook it since it is such a small part of that huge thread, so i'm making a separate post about it.

THE FACTS:

- this week circuit city has thief on sale for $34.99.

- circuit city accepts competitor's coupons.

- target has an online coupon for $15 off thief for xbox that you can print out.



THE PLAN:

- print out this coupon

- take it to circuit city

- get a copy of thief (for xbox)

- take it to the service desk

- hand them the game and the coupon.


then you should be walking out of there with a copy of thief: deadly shadows for xbox for only $19.99 + tax (just like i did last night)!
